Public bug reported:
1. Install the latest Ubuntu security update for ghostscript (since this
does not appear to have been released for zesty, it is a bit easier to
do this from Ubuntu 16.10 than from 17.04).
2. Install libspectre1 0.2.8-1 (from zesty or zesty-proposed).
3. Open a .eps with Evince, Ubuntu's default viewer for eps files.
Here's a test file:
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/libspectre/+bug/1348384/+attachment/4171120/+files/countrate.eps
What happens:
The .eps fails to display. If run from a terminal, this is output:
invalidaccess -7
Earlier version of libspectre (I tested Ubuntu 14.04 and 16.10) still
handle the test .eps file ok.
